King of the Dark

di Ariana Nash

UtentiRecensioniPopolaritàMedia votiConversazioni
354697,628 (4.4)Nessuno
"Your love is worthless, it's your hate I need." Prince Vasili Caville When King Talos Caville surrendered the war to the elves, soldier Nikolas Yazdan vowed never to serve the royals again. He said the same to the prince who tried to buy his loyalty, and learned that the Caville princes don't take no for an answer. Whipped for his insolence, Nikolas is also forced into slavery in a palace full of vicious, brutal royals. Prince Vasili is the worst Caville of all. Malicious and cruel, the prince is more viper than man, and someone inside the palace wants him dead. Nikolas would kill the prince himself if not for one thing: Julian, the prince's personal guard and Niko's light in the dark. If Nikolas doesn't submit to Prince Vasili and discover who is plotting against him, Julian will suffer. But there's more wrong in the palace than just the prince. The king is on his deathbed, the ferocious elves are creeping closer to the great city of Loreen, and madness stalks the hallways. There's poison in the Caville court, and if Nikolas doesn't discover the real reason Prince Vasili tried to buy him with a bag of coin, the palace, the city, and everything he loves, will be lost forever.… (altro)

*I received an ARC of this book in exchange for an honest review*

Ariana Nash should be an auto-buy for everyone who enjoys reading dark, intricate M/M romance. She’s one of the few authors whose work haven’t let me down ONCE. Seriously, I don’t know how she does that. Every story is better than the last, and King of the Dark might be her best book yet. It’s definitely my new favorite, and I’m really excited to be one of the first people to read and review it.



As soon as I got my copy (and stopped fangirling…), there was only me and the book - I could not put it down and finished it in one sitting. The blurb promised great things - a gay GOT/Witcher combo - so the bar was set pretty damn high, but it somehow surpassed my expectations!

A couple of chapters in, I was already thoroughly immersed and enjoying the lovely worldbuilding, but I was also experiencing a vague déja vu. Vasili kind of reminded me of Captive Prince’s Laurent - he was this cold, untouchable prince with a dark and mysterious past, carrying most (but not all) of his scars on the inside, always a few steps ahead of his enemies. Niko shared some of CP’s Damen’s characteristics, too, but to a far lesser degree - Vasili’s complete opposite, he was a blunt, no-nonsense soldier with a short fuse, who took no shit from anyone. Despite being pretty jaded after all he’d been through in the past, on some level he was still too trusting, and easily deceived.

Fortunately, any similarities ended here. The plot was wonderfully dark and twisted, and completely unpredictable. Suffice to say that just when the author had me totally convinced the story was moving in one direction, it did a complete one-eighty - which, in retrospect, was something I should’ve expected, as she seems to delight in stringing her readers along (and they secretly like it, too)! Here’s my advice to my fellow readers: do not fish for spoilers, and just go in blind - that way, you’ll get the most out of this one.

There’s no need to go on at length about Nash’s wonderful writing style. Her voice is unique and very engaging, here even more so than in her previous works. The book was also beautifully edited and typo-free - truly a balm for this finicky reader’s eyes. I really liked Niko’s POV, but it’d be even better if the future installments allowed the readers a glimpse into Vasili’s complicated mind. That man is a complete enigma, and I can’t wait to get to know his inner workings.

King of the Dark is a strong start to a fantastic series, and I can’t recommend it enough. As always, I’m on the lookout for more releases from this amazing author. ( )

Is this series just another"Captive Prince" clone?

Ok, I noticed a few similarities to captive prince, mostly between the actual princes of both books. On the surface, they both come across as treacherous and cruel. Both prince's are almost asexual on the surface, especially compared to those around them. There's the rumor going around that neither one of them have dicks. They are both cold fuckers. Icey cold. And I believe they may share similar physical characteristics. I could go on, but really it doesn't matter. This book is awesome and it's unlike "Captive Prince" in every other way. Plus with " King of the Dark" you don't have to wait a couple of books before things start to get spicy.

If you are thinking about reading this stop reading other reviews now and just do it or you are going to get spoilers that will take away from some jaw dropping revelations that make this such a great read. The entire climax was giving me everything I needed. In fact the last 20% of this book are so good I would recommend reading just for that. ( )
